Do sunfish live alone or travel in groups?

Sunfish, or mola, typically live alone or in small groups rather than in large schools. They are often solitary creatures, but they can occasionally be found in pairs or small groups, particularly during mating seasons. Their solitary nature helps them conserve energy and reduces competition for food. However, they do gather in certain areas for cleaning and to bask in the sun.
